Formerly a Nurenberg tram, MAN GT6 articulated twin-set No. 184 accelerates away from Ochtona Juwentus tram stop working a No. 18 service for Lagiewniki on 21st March 2011. Built between 1962 and 1966 many GT6's were acquired second hand from Nurenberg in the early 1990's with the last not being withdrawn until 2013. Of interest is the Nurenberg city crest carried on the far side of the cab front of No. 184 along with the Krakow city crest on the near cab front.
